Travel Agent Pivot Paths

Event Planner

Move into an adjacent coordination role managing venues vendors and guest logistics for meetings or celebrations. The transition is practical because itinerary planning skills transfer well.

Typical Salary: $65000-$95000

Skills Needed: vendor coordination, scheduling, budgeting, client communication

Difficulty: Moderate

Concierge

Shift into a more human centered hospitality role where customized recommendations and service recovery are more AI resilient.

Typical Salary: $55k-$85k

Skills Needed: guest service, itinerary planning, communication, local knowledge

Difficulty: Easy

Event Coordinator

Move into an adjacent planning role organizing group travel venues and logistics for events.

Typical Salary: $65k-$95k

Skills Needed: event planning, vendor coordination, scheduling, budgeting

Difficulty: Moderate
